2.2 Content architecture and internal linking for authority

Structure content around pillar pages that cover core topics (e.g., gaming safety, payments, and responsible gambling) and cluster articles that dive into specifics (how-to guides, FAQs, regulatory updates). Internal linking should create a logical graph that passes authority from pillar pages to clusters and back, enabling search engines to discover related content and users to navigate easily. Implement breadcrumb trails, consistent URL structures, and schema markup for articles, FAQs, and product pages. A well-planned content architecture accelerates indexation of new pages and supports 2025 updates in regulations and promotions.

2.3 On-page optimization: meta, headings, UX signals

On-page optimization should focus on clear meta titles and descriptions that reflect user intent, with headings that signal hierarchy and topics. Use structured data to annotate reviews, promotions, and FAQs. Improve UX signals by reducing CLS (Cumulative Layout Shift), ensuring mobile responsiveness, and delivering fast page loads. Rich media (videos, explainer animations) can boost engagement when paired with scannable text and bullet lists. Accessibility improvements (alt text, keyboard navigation) broaden potential audience and boost SEO performance.

5.2 2025 regulatory landscape and ethical considerations

Regulatory landscapes in 2025 demand proactive compliance and ethical marketing. Stay ahead with ongoing monitoring of licensing requirements, AML/KYC protocols, responsible gaming commitments, and data privacy standards (e.g., GDPR-like frameworks in new markets). Transparently communicate policies and ensure that marketing practices avoid targeting underage or vulnerable audiences. Build internal governance processes to review new promotions and features for compliance and ethics before launch.
